FREMONT, CA: Rethink Ed is a comprehensive K-12 solution that promotes well-being, connectivity, and achievement by concentrating on the entire school community and supporting healthy and confident children and adults. As part of the annual SIIA CODiE Awards, the Rethink Ed Social and Emotional Learning Mental Health platform were voted the best Student Learning Capacity-Building Solution of 2021. The renowned CODiE Awards honor the firms that create the most innovative educational technology products in the United States and around the world.
"We cannot address learning loss without first addressing the wellness of our educators and students," stated Diana Frezza, Senior Vice President for Rethink Ed, "We're honored that Rethink Social and Emotional Learning and Mental Health has been named as the 2021 EdTech CODiE winner for the "Best Student Learning Capacity-Building Solution category" and look forward to continuing on this important journey as schools prepare for a new school year."

"Congratulations to the 2021 Ed Tech CODiE Award winners," stated SIIA President Jeff Joseph. "The COVID-19 pandemic reminds us of the importance of innovative Ed Tech products and services and this year's class takes a special place among the many amazing products recognized across the 35-year history of the CODiE Awards."
